Least Common Multiple of 89968 and 89973 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 89968 and 89973,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(89968,89973) = 1
LCM(89968,89973) = ( 89968 × 89973) / 1
LCM(89968,89973) = 8094690864 / 1
LCM(89968,89973) = 8094690864
